Holiness
The sermon emphasizes the necessity of adopting a divine perspective to navigate life's challenges, viewing problems as tools for spiritual growth rather than mere obstacles. It outlines practical steps for holiness, including making covenants with one's eyes and ears, and developing 'hind's feet' to walk in high places with God. The speaker warns against relying solely on biblical knowledge without corresponding spiritual vitality, illustrating the need to admit sin, commit it to God, and forgive others. Central to this transformation is the discipline of meditation and the intentional practice of putting off old behaviors while putting on new, godly habits. Ultimately, the message encourages believers to seek a fresh, experiential relationship with God through consistent spiritual disciplines and reliance on Scripture.
